Anantpura
Anantpura is a village located in Palera tehsil of Tikamgarh district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Palera (tehsildar office) and 55km away from district headquarter Tikamgarh. As per 2009 stats, Bhagwant Pura is the gram panchayat of Anantpura village.

About Anantpura
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Anantpura is 456928. The village spans a total geographical area of 299.53 hectares. Jatara is nearest town to Anantpura village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

Population of Anantpura
Below is a concise population overview of Anantpura as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 325 | 168 | 157 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 52 | 23 | 29 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 241 | 126 | 115 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 178 | 113 | 65 |
Illiterate Population | 147 | 55 | 92 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Anantpura village:
- The total population of Anantpura village is around 325, including approximately 168 males and 157 females, with a sex ratio of 934 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 52 children aged 0–6 years in Anantpura village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Anantpura village has 241 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Anantpura village is about 54.77%, with male literacy at 67.26% and female literacy at 41.40%.
- There are around 61 households in Anantpura village.
